Key things to Look for in Quality Roof Services
When searching for quality roofing services, homeowners should prioritize several important factors to guarantee a lasting and dependable installation. First, they should review the contractor's experience and expertise in the roofing industry. A well-established company with a solid track record is more likely to deliver high-quality workmanship. Next, it is essential to check customer testimonials and ratings to assess overall satisfaction. Homeowners should also ask about the materials used, as superior materials contribute to the longevity of a roof. Insurance and licensing are vital; reputable contractors carry liability insurance and are properly licensed to operate in the area. Finally, getting multiple quotes allows homeowners to analyze pricing and services, ensuring they get fair value. By focusing on these factors, homeowners can make informed decisions when choosing trusted roofing services that satisfy their needs.

How can you assess if a roofer is reliable?
What approach can homeowners take to determine a roofer's dependability? To assess a roofer's credibility, homeowners should start by checking for appropriate licensing and insurance. A trustworthy roofer will have the necessary licenses, which vary by state, ensuring adherence with local regulations. Insurance is equally important, as it safeguards property owners from possible liabilities during the roofing process.
Then, seeking out references and examining online reviews can give insight into the roofer's track record. A credible professional will gladly share testimonials from content clients. Property owners should also ask about guarantees on both materials and labor, as these assurances indicate the roofer's belief in their work.
Finally, requesting various quotes can support homeowners determine pricing and services offered. A trustworthy roofer will submit a detailed proposal, clearly outlining the nature of work and connected expenses, facilitating informed decision-making.
Leading Roofing Options: Types of Materials and Their Benefits
Roof coverings play an essential role in the overall performance and longevity of a home. Multiple roofing options are offered, each delivering particular advantages suited to individual requirements. Asphalt shingles are popular for their low cost and straightforward setup, ensuring steadfast protection against the elements. Metal roofing distinguishes itself for its durability and energy efficiency, often lasting longer than traditional materials. Clay and concrete tiles offer a distinctive aesthetic and outstanding temperature regulation, making them suitable for warmer climates.
Wood shakes or shingles, while needing additional upkeep, provide a natural look and good insulation. Furthermore, man-made materials, such as rubber or composite shingles, blend the appearance of traditional options with enhanced durability and lower maintenance requirements. Each material presents unique benefits, allowing homeowners to choose based on cost, weather conditions, and preferred style, ultimately enhancing the home's structural quality and worth.

Identifying Common Roofing Issues and Their Fixes
Common roof issues can significantly affect the integrity of a home. Among the most frequently encountered problems are water seepage, which can result from broken shingles, faulty flashing, or deteriorated sealants. Detecting leaks promptly is critical, as they can lead to substantial water harm if not addressed. Another common issue is the growth of algae and moss, which can compromise the roof's appearance and durability. Regularly cleaning the roof can mitigate this issue.
Additionally, damaged or absent shingles are indicative of deterioration, often necessitating substitution to preserve defense against the elements. Poor ventilation can also result in thermal accumulation, resulting in premature aging of roofing materials. Property owners are recommended to conduct regular inspections and contact roofing specialists for solutions customized for particular problems. Timely identification and correction of these common problems can considerably extend a roof's longevity and protect the home's overall structure.

Consistent Assessments Hold Significance
Regular inspections play a crucial role in prolonging the life of a roof. By discover here detecting problems in advance, homeowners can stop small issues from becoming severe into major deterioration. A comprehensive evaluation typically includes checking for missing shingles, assessing flashing condition, and inspecting gutters for accumulated debris. These assessments allow for prompt action, ensuring that the roof stays waterproof and structurally intact. Furthermore, periodic checks can help adjust upkeep plans based on changing weather conditions, which may affect roof functionality. Establishing a regular inspection schedule, ideally twice a year, enables property owners to stay actively engaged in roof maintenance. This diligence not only enhances the roof's durability but also adds to the total worth of the property, making it a wise investment.

What Timeframe Does a Typical Roofing Project Take to Conclude?
A routine roofing assignment often takes 1-2 weeks to conclude, relying on multiple factors such as the roof size, material type, meteorological conditions, and any unexpected obstacles that may happen during the execution.
What Protection Are Provided on Roof Installation?
Service warranties on roofing typically cover workmanship warranties covering one to ten years and material coverage lasting up to 50 years. The specifics often rely on the roofing materials used and the roofing firm's policies.
Do I Need a License for Roofing Work?
Yes, a license is commonly mandated for roofing work, depending on local ordinances and the scope of the project. Homeowners should consult with their local authorities to confirm compliance with necessary structural standards and permits.
How Can I Prepare My Home for Roofing Installation?
Preparing a home set up for roofing installation involves removing clutter from the yard, taking away exterior furniture, keeping pets safely inside, and making sure easy access to the roof for laborers and equipment.
What Should I Do if My Roof Develops Leaks After Installation?
If a roof seeps after setup, the homeowner should promptly contact the roofing contractor for inspection. Document the issue with photos, and guarantee all dialogue is explicit to promote expedient maintenance and prevent further harm.
